Output ddc8c9144d38be2d9a7176c33718696a2a817eb296af0a5f2b950fef948986a7:0

value
2129885756
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d825d0de90bdff4eda5adf769b96cfc8af81616e4f56849f8842568ed2cd6091
address
tb1pmqjaph5shhl5akj6mamfh9k0ezhczctwfatgf8uggftga5kdvzgsyuutly
transaction
ddc8c9144d38be2d9a7176c33718696a2a817eb296af0a5f2b950fef948986a7
confirmations
68553
spent
true